Output e95cb9133c01e45dec02c65729f5b8601e002879905d4e33f9a5235b0a5259c7:1

value
6488400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c03a29c2ac879c37486ce9ebad4aed2e402b26f OP_EQUAL
address
3Jq9KBismfHUZFGHYjdanmAM51NatMzZoX
transaction
e95cb9133c01e45dec02c65729f5b8601e002879905d4e33f9a5235b0a5259c7
confirmations
313935
spent
true